diff --git a/cddl/lib/libzpool/Makefile b/cddl/lib/libzpool/Makefile index 9361d352f7c..0c680367956 100644 --- a/cddl/lib/libzpool/Makefile +++ b/cddl/lib/libzpool/Makefile @@ -281,7 +281,6 @@ CFLAGS+= -DWANTS_MUTEX_OWNED CFLAGS+= -I${SRCTOP}/lib/libpthread/thread CFLAGS+= -I${SRCTOP}/lib/libpthread/sys CFLAGS+= -I${SRCTOP}/lib/libthr/arch/${MACHINE_CPUARCH}/include -CFLAGS.gcc+= -fms-extensions LIBADD= md pthread z spl icp nvpair avl umem diff --git a/cddl/usr.bin/ztest/Makefile b/cddl/usr.bin/ztest/Makefile index 83c7b0eee13..89ee381f38e 100644 --- a/cddl/usr.bin/ztest/Makefile +++ b/cddl/usr.bin/ztest/Makefile @@ -28,7 +28,6 @@ CSTD= c99 # Since there are many asserts in this program, it makes no sense to compile # it without debugging. CFLAGS+= -g -DDEBUG=1 -Wno-format -DZFS_DEBUG=1 -CFLAGS.gcc+= -fms-extensions HAS_TESTS= SUBDIR.${MK_TESTS}+= tests diff --git a/cddl/usr.sbin/zdb/Makefile b/cddl/usr.sbin/zdb/Makefile index 8bf07cb4c06..239299aa1d6 100644 --- a/cddl/usr.sbin/zdb/Makefile +++ b/cddl/usr.sbin/zdb/Makefile @@ -24,7 +24,6 @@ CFLAGS+= \ LIBADD= nvpair umem zdb zfs_core zfs spl avl zutil zpool crypto pthread -CFLAGS.gcc+= -fms-extensions # Since there are many asserts in this program, it makes no sense to compile # it without debugging. CFLAGS+= -g -DDEBUG=1 -DZFS_DEBUG=1 diff --git a/sys/conf/kern.pre.mk b/sys/conf/kern.pre.mk index 3dc1efe3d5d..a5b21cdbe84 100644 --- a/sys/conf/kern.pre.mk +++ b/sys/conf/kern.pre.mk @@ -78,10 +78,9 @@ CFLAGS= ${COPTFLAGS} ${DEBUG} CFLAGS+= ${INCLUDES} -D_KERNEL -DHAVE_KERNEL_OPTION_HEADERS -include opt_global.h CFLAGS_PARAM_INLINE_UNIT_GROWTH?=100 CFLAGS_PARAM_LARGE_FUNCTION_GROWTH?=1000 -CFLAGS.gcc+= -fms-extensions -finline-limit=${INLINE_LIMIT} +CFLAGS.gcc+= -finline-limit=${INLINE_LIMIT} CFLAGS.gcc+= --param inline-unit-growth=${CFLAGS_PARAM_INLINE_UNIT_GROWTH} CFLAGS.gcc+= --param large-function-growth=${CFLAGS_PARAM_LARGE_FUNCTION_GROWTH} -CFLAGS.gcc+= -fms-extensions .if defined(CFLAGS_ARCH_PARAMS) CFLAGS.gcc+=${CFLAGS_ARCH_PARAMS} .endif diff --git a/sys/conf/kmod.mk b/sys/conf/kmod.mk index aacd7a17ef9..c35116dfcaa 100644 --- a/sys/conf/kmod.mk +++ b/sys/conf/kmod.mk @@ -139,7 +139,6 @@ CFLAGS+= -include ${.OBJDIR}/opt_global.h CFLAGS+= -I. -I${SYSDIR} -I${SYSDIR}/contrib/ck/include CFLAGS.gcc+= -finline-limit=${INLINE_LIMIT} -CFLAGS.gcc+= -fms-extensions CFLAGS.gcc+= --param inline-unit-growth=100 CFLAGS.gcc+= --param large-function-growth=1000 diff --git a/sys/modules/iser/Makefile b/sys/modules/iser/Makefile index ff08ae6f346..2c00b3a4027 100644 --- a/sys/modules/iser/Makefile +++ b/sys/modules/iser/Makefile @@ -17,7 +17,6 @@ CFLAGS+= -I${SYSDIR}/ofed/include/uapi CFLAGS+= ${LINUXKPI_INCLUDES} CFLAGS+= -DCONFIG_INFINIBAND_USER_MEM CFLAGS+= -DINET6 -DINET -CFLAGS+= -fms-extensions CFLAGS+=-DICL_KERNEL_PROXY diff --git a/sys/modules/pms/Makefile b/sys/modules/pms/Makefile index 8bd21fc4b50..81599e0a3ce 100644 --- a/sys/modules/pms/Makefile +++ b/sys/modules/pms/Makefile @@ -17,7 +17,6 @@ ${SRCTOP}/sys/dev/pms/freebsd/driver/common CFLAGS+=-fno-builtin -CFLAGS+=-fms-extensions CFLAGS+=-Wredundant-decls CFLAGS+=-Wunused-variable diff --git a/sys/powerpc/conf/dpaa/config.dpaa b/sys/powerpc/conf/dpaa/config.dpaa index 6a923baed89..0b7c8fcf3b2 100644 --- a/sys/powerpc/conf/dpaa/config.dpaa +++ b/sys/powerpc/conf/dpaa/config.dpaa @@ -2,7 +2,7 @@ files "dpaa/files.dpaa" makeoptions DPAA_COMPILE_CMD="${LINUXKPI_C} ${DPAAWARNFLAGS} \ - -Wno-cast-qual -Wno-unused-function -Wno-init-self -fms-extensions \ + -Wno-cast-qual -Wno-unused-function -Wno-init-self \ -include $S/contrib/ncsw/build/dflags.h \ -Wno-error=missing-prototypes \ -I$S/contrib/ncsw/build/ \